Hugh Grant refused entry to Fringe show
Hugh Grant was on a golfing holiday to Scotland. Picture: Jane Barlow
His face may be recognised around the world, but that wasn’t enough for bouncers at a Fringe venue, who denied actor Hugh Grant access to a comedy show at the weekend.
Grant had hoped to watch the American stand-up Eddie Pepitone at The Tron pub just off the Royal Mile in Edinburgh but his 10-strong group were refused entry by bouncers on the door because some of them did not have identification.
The star of Four Weddings and a Funeral had arrived for the 11.40pm show in the basement of the venue on Friday night but were forced to walk away by the doormen.
There were many reported sightings of Grant around the Edinburgh festival on Twitter over the weekend.
He is in Scotland for a golfing holiday.
